• Facebook is ditching its plans to build internet-providing drones, it announced on Tuesday.
  • The revelation comes after Business Insider reported on upheaval at the Aquila project, including the departure of its leader and a planned redesign.
  • The company is now closing the facility in England where the 747-sized drones were being developed, and 16 staff have been laid off.

read more on Business Insider